Output d286248ec761707d50bb90d8bc43f1c1dc0848ffa72e3ee97a014e2cf942226c:1

value
18267217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2590ed09c957eeafd8afc39c876b2267873764 OP_EQUAL
address
36zU7ouLyqmfkgtcgEMePjZA9CSDQs4RQK
transaction
d286248ec761707d50bb90d8bc43f1c1dc0848ffa72e3ee97a014e2cf942226c
spent
true